Michigan Rise is a venture capital firm and a subsidiary of the Michigan State University Research Foundation, established in 1973. The firm focuses on advancing economic development through technology commercialization and provides early-stage funding to Michigan-based startups. It collaborates with the Michigan Economic Development Corporation (MEDC) to support local entrepreneurs.
Michigan Rise invests in early-stage technology startups across sectors such as AgTech, HealthTech, CleanTech, energy, education, and workforce software. The firm typically engages with pre-seed to seed+ stage companies, aiming to connect founders with essential resources and support to scale their businesses effectively.
Michigan Rise has backed several notable startups, including 86Repairs, a platform for restaurant equipment repair and maintenance; BridgeCare Technologies, a chat-based coaching platform; and Shifty, which focuses on improving training and retention for restaurant teams.

Michigan Rise often leads funding rounds for early-stage startups, providing essential capital and resources to help them grow.
The firm is open to follow-on investments, especially for companies that demonstrate significant growth potential and alignment with their investment thesis.
Specific fund size details are not disclosed, but Michigan Rise operates with a focus on early-stage investments in Michigan-based startups.
